Lyngbya capillaris Hindák 1985

Publication Details
Lyngbya capillaris Hindák 1985: 945

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Lyngbya is Lyngbya confervoides C.Agardh ex Gomont.

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Planktolyngbya capillaris (Hindák) Anagnostidis & Komárek.

Origin of Species Name
Adjective (Latin), capillary, hair-like, thread-like (Stearn 1973).

General Environment
This is a freshwater species.
